AI Summary
-
Adds Department of Children and Family Services (DCFS) employees to the list of protected classes under Illinois aggravated battery law.
-
Creates a Class 1 felony for knowingly causing great bodily harm, permanent disability, or disfigurement to a DCFS employee performing official duties, being prevented from performing duties, or being battered in retaliation for official duties.
-
Creates a Class 2 felony for battering a DCFS employee (without causing great bodily harm) while performing official duties, being prevented from performing duties, or being battered in retaliation for official duties.
-
Aligns DCFS employee protections with existing protections for peace officers, firefighters, correctional institution employees, and other public servants under aggravated battery statutes.
